In devotion to the Trinity

Glorious Father in heaven, through your divine wisdom, you have invited some men and women to embrace a life of profound dedication. By living in prayerful adherence to the commitments of poverty, celibacy, and obedience, they serve as models for us, reminding us, as St. Paul teaches, that our ultimate home is in heaven. Bestow upon them, O Lord, the gift of joy and steadfastness in their sacred calling. We ask this in the name of Christ, our Lord. Amen.

Who is the patron saint of Trinitarian Religious?

St. José de Jesús y María is recognized as the patron saint of Trinitarian Religious, embodying the spirit of the Holy Trinity.

Why St. José de Jesús y María?

His life and dedication to the Trinitarian order exemplify the commitment to living out the mystery of the Trinity in daily life.

Is there a patron saint of religious orders?

Various saints serve as patrons for different religious orders, but St. José specifically represents those dedicated to the Trinity.
